Toronto-based Jamie Kennedy is one of Canada’s most celebrated chefs, known for his legendary commitment to environmental issues and his support of sustainable agriculture, local producers and traditional methods. What we do. The cafe closed down in March, 2015. The farm garden supplies beautiful tomatoes, potatoes, onions, garlic, and many other vegetables and herbs to Jamie Kennedy Kitchens. Jamie Kennedy Kitchens has been involved in fostering relationships and helping to redefine and revitalize local food economies in Southern Ontario for more than 3 decades.
